I've been using Garmin GPS V units for a few years now and had something odd happen today. I have 2 units that I regularly use, one in the FJ60 and the second as a field unit. I turned on the Cruiser unit this morning, it went through the typical booting up, acquired satellites then blanked out. I restarted the GPS several times on both AA battery power and with the hard wired connector. Same thing each time. When the unit would blank out there would be a single line on the screen and the only way to shut it off would be to cut power. So I was thinking that this particular unit was wearing out.
Several hours later while out on a river I pulled out the second GPS V, powered it up and as soon as satellites were acquired it went to the blank screen with a single line. This one was exhibiting exactly the same problem as the other GPS - power up, acquire satellites, go to blank screen with single line, and to shut off power had to be disconnected.
